diff --git a/src/BinaryUuidBuilder.php b/src/BinaryUuidBuilder.php new file mode 100644 index 0000000..9b3d583 --- /dev/null +++ b/src/BinaryUuidBuilder.php @@ -0,0 +1,137 @@ + + */ +class BinaryUuidBuilder extends Builder +{ + /** + * Add a basic where clause to the query. + * + * Automatically converts UUID strings to binary when querying + * columns that use the EfficientUuid cast. + * + * @param \Closure|string|array|\Illuminate\Contracts\Database\Query\Expression $column + * @param mixed $operator + * @param mixed $value + * @param string $boolean + * @return $this + */ + public function where($column, $operator = null, $value = null, $boolean = 'and') + { + // Check if this is a simple where clause on a UUID column + if (is_string($column) && $this->shouldConvertToUuidBinary($column, $value ?? $operator)) { + $actualValue = func_num_args() === 2 ? $operator : $value; + + if (is_string($actualValue) && Uuid::isValid($actualValue)) { + // Convert UUID string to binary + $binaryValue = Uuid::fromString($actualValue)->getBytes(); + + if (func_num_args() === 2) { + return parent::where($column, '=', $binaryValue, $boolean); + } + + return parent::where($column, $operator, $binaryValue, $boolean); + } + } + + return parent::where($column, $operator, $value, $boolean); + } + + /** + * Add a "where in" clause to the query. + * + * Automatically converts arrays of UUID strings to binary format. + * This is crucial for eager loading (with()) and other bulk queries. + * + * @param \Illuminate\Contracts\Database\Query\Expression|string $column + * @param mixed $values + * @param string $boolean + * @param bool $not + * @return $this + */ + public function whereIn($column, $values, $boolean = 'and', $not = false) + { + if (is_string($column) && $this->isUuidColumn($column)) { + // Convert array of UUID strings to binary + $values = collect($values)->map(function ($value) { + if (is_string($value) && Uuid::isValid($value)) { + return Uuid::fromString($value)->getBytes(); + } + + return $value; + })->all(); + } + + return parent::whereIn($column, $values, $boolean, $not); + } + + /** + * Add a "where not in" clause to the query. + * + * Automatically converts arrays of UUID strings to binary format. + * + * @param \Illuminate\Contracts\Database\Query\Expression|string $column + * @param mixed $values + * @param string $boolean + * @return $this + */ + public function whereNotIn($column, $values, $boolean = 'and') + { + return $this->whereIn($column, $values, $boolean, true); + } + + /** + * Check if column should convert UUID string to binary. + */ + protected function shouldConvertToUuidBinary(string $column, mixed $value): bool + { + return $this->isUuidColumn($column) && is_string($value) && Uuid::isValid($value); + } + + /** + * Check if a column uses UUID binary cast (EfficientUuid). + */ + protected function isUuidColumn(string $column): bool + { + $model = $this->getModel(); + + // Remove table prefix if present (e.g., 'users.id' -> 'id') + $columnName = str_contains($column, '.') + ? substr($column, strrpos($column, '.') + 1) + : $column; + + // Get casts from the model + $casts = $model->getCasts(); + + if (! isset($casts[$columnName])) { + return false; + } + + $castType = $casts[$columnName]; + + // Handle string class names + if (is_string($castType)) { + return $castType === Casts\EfficientUuid::class + || $castType === 'Dyrynda\Database\Support\Casts\EfficientUuid'; + } + + // Handle object instances (Laravel 12+) + return $castType instanceof Casts\EfficientUuid; + } +} diff --git a/src/UsesBinaryUuidBuilder.php b/src/UsesBinaryUuidBuilder.php new file mode 100644 index 0000000..6ffc8f0 --- /dev/null +++ b/src/UsesBinaryUuidBuilder.php @@ -0,0 +1,58 @@ + EfficientUuid::class];
